Crafting Your Authentic Voice

Crafting your authentic voice in your essays is crucial for creating a compelling and engaging narrative. Your voice is what differentiates your writing from others, and it allows you to connect with your readers on a personal level. To develop your authentic voice, it is important to reflect on your own experiences, values, and beliefs. Ask yourself what makes you unique and what you want to share with the world.

When writing in your authentic voice, it is important to be honest and genuine. Do not try to be someone you are not, as this will come across as inauthentic and disingenuous. Instead, embrace your own unique perspective and share your thoughts and feelings in a way that is true to you.

Developing your authentic voice takes time and practice. Do not be discouraged if you do not find your voice immediately. Keep writing and experimenting, and eventually, you will discover your own unique way of expressing yourself.

Revising and Refining Your Work

Once you have written a draft of your essay, it is important to take the time to revise and refine your work. This means taking a critical look at what you have written and making changes to improve the clarity, coherence, and impact of your essay. Here are some tips for revising and refining your work:

  1. Take a break from your essay. Once you have finished writing a draft, it is helpful to take a break from your essay for a few hours or even a day. This will give you some distance from your work and allow you to come back to it with fresh eyes.
  2. Read your essay aloud. This will help you to identify any awkward phrasing or sentences that are difficult to understand. You can also use a text-to-speech program to have your essay read aloud to you.
  3. Check for grammar and spelling errors. While you should always proofread your work for grammar and spelling errors, it is especially important to do so after you have revised your essay. This will help to ensure that your essay is free of errors that could distract your reader.
  4. Get feedback from others. If you have a friend, family member, or teacher who is willing to read your essay, ask them for feedback. They can provide you with valuable insights into your writing and help you to identify areas that need improvement. Do not be afraid to ask for help from others.
  5. Be patient and persistent. Revising and refining your work takes time and effort. Do not get discouraged if you do not see immediate results. Just keep working at it and you will eventually see improvement in your writing.By following these tips, you can help to ensure that your essay is clear, coherent, and impactful. So take the time to revise and refine your work, and you will be rewarded with a well-written essay that you can be proud of.
